How much do flight test tech j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for flight test tech in California is $113,494.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$98,700.00 and $128,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Flight Test T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Flight Test Tech, you need a strong background in aircraft systems, mechanical aptitude, and typically an associate degree or relevant technical certification in aviation maintenance. Familiarity with flight data acquisition systems, avionics testing tools, and adherence to FAA regulations are essential for the role.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ective teamwork are crucial soft skills for conducting safe and accurate flight tests. These competencies ensure the reliability, safety, and compliance of aircraft during test operations.

What is the difference between Flight Test Tech vs Aircraft Maintenance Technician?

AspectFlight Test TechAircraft Maintenance Technician
Required CertificationsFAA certifications, specialized flight test trainingFAA Airframe & Powerplant (A&P) license
Work EnvironmentFlight testing aircraft, often outdoors, in aircraft hangarsMaintenance facilities, hangars, repair shops
Industry UsagePrimarily in aerospace and aircraft manufacturersCommercial, private, and military aircraft maintenance
Job FocusTesting aircraft performance and systems during flightRepairing, inspecting, and maintaining aircraft

While both roles require FAA certifications and involve working with aircraft, Flight Test Techs focus on conducting flight tests to evaluate aircraft performance, often in collaboration with engineers. Aircraft Maintenance Technicians handle routine repairs and inspections on aircraft on the ground. The two roles complement each other within the aerospace industry but differ in their primary responsibilities and work environments.

What are some common challenges flight test technicians face during test campaigns?

Flight test technicians often encounter challenges such as adapting to rapidly changing test schedules, working in variable weather conditions, and troubleshooting unexpected technical issues on the aircraft. They must maintain a high level of attention to detail to ensure safety and data accuracy, especially when working with complex test instrumentation. Collaboration with engineers, pilots, and other technicians is essential to address issues quickly and keep test programs on track. Flexibility, clear communication, and strong problem-solving skills are key to successfully navigating these challenges.

What are Flight Test Techs?

Flight Test Technicians, often called Flight Test Techs, are specialized professionals who assist in the testing and evaluation of aircraft systems and components. They work closely with engineers and pilots to set up, monitor, and record data from test flights, ensuring all equipment is functioning properly and safely. Their responsibilities can include installing instrumentation, troubleshooting technical issues, and maintaining detailed records of test results. Flight Test Techs play a crucial role in ensuring the safety and performance of new or modified aircraft before they enter regular service.

Northrop Grumman Aeronautics Systems has an opening for a Flight Test Technician 3/Flight Test Technician 4 to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als supporting our Lab Test Center of Technical Excellence for Test and Evaluation. This position will be located on site in Palmdale, CA.

The Lab Test Team is looking for an experienced Flight Test Technician with instrumentation test experience, good communication skills and a team centric approach. In this role, you will be performing a variety of duties assisting test engineers in the development of electrical, mechanical, and data systems. This could include but not limited to engineering designs, tests, fabrications, modifications, assemblies, and components. The selected candidate also will set up and test lab subassemblies under operational conditions. This will include fabricated and routed harness assemblies and installations. Prospective candidates will become familiar with the hardware and methodology used in systems, test setup, and data acquisition hardware as well as related sensors, e.g., LVDT, strain gages, string pots, load cells, torque transducers, and optical and audio sensors.

The selected individual must be capable of working as an individual contributor as well as part of a team. Selected candidate must be a motivated, driven individual with excellent communication skills, capable of successfully completing statement of work with somewhat minimal oversight/supervision. Individuals will follow the instructions of Vehicle Managers, Senior Technicians, or Engineers/Test Conductors, and must be able to read and interpret technical documents, such as drawings, schematics, sketches, procedures, technical orders etc.

Responsibilities Include:

  • Test, troubleshooting, removal, installation, modification, and maintenance of aerospace systems including, but not limited to fuel, hydraulics, ECS, flight controls, propulsion, landing gear, CNI, and ground support equipment.

  • Operate ground equipment, aerospace systems checkout, perform pre and post-use inspections, service fuel, lubrication, cooling, and other requirements as necessary.

  • Other responsibilities may include the application of materials, appliques, coatings, decals, primer, and paint.

  • Read and interpret schematics, engineering drawings, and written or verbal instructions to fabricate and assemble necessary fixtures and/or components.

  • Execute testing in accordance with direction provided by senior technician/engineering staff

  • Conducting tests and reporting data in the prescribed format, using predetermined methods, sequences, and setups to inspect or test specific equipment or products.

  • Must be willing to work a flexible work schedule that may include extended shifts, holidays, and weekends as required

  • Adhere to all required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) and safety guidelines and regulations

  • Work and communicate over ambient noise

  • Work in a variety of work spaces/positions. Work spaces may include but are not limited to small, enclosed spaces, awkward, and elevated spaces. Positions may include bending, twisting, kneeling, crawling, ascending/descending ladders, and/or working overhead.

  • Travel domestically and internationally up to 10-25% to support other site locations, Military Bases, and other various Program needs
